Detailed information
Overview
| Name | pilF | Type | Machinery gene |
| Locus tag | DMO12_RS02740 | Genome accession | NZ_CP031380 |
| Coordinates | 573904..574704 (+) | Length | 266 a.a. |
| NCBI ID | WP_002027454.1 | Uniprot ID | - |
| Organism | Acinetobacter baumannii ACICU | ||
| Function | assembly of type IV pilus (predicted from homology) DNA binding and uptake |
